John Cross of Hose 1776 Will

Leicestershire, Leicester and Rutland Archives, Leicestershire Wills and Probate Records 1776

In the name of God Amen I John Cross the elder of the parish of Hose in the County of Leicester being mindfull of my mortality do make and ordain this my Last Will and testament in manner Following that is to say first and principally I Commend my Soul to the Almighty who gave it and my Body to the dust from whence it was taken to be decently interred at the charge and discretion of my Executor hereinafter named

And for those Worldly goods of which I may die possess’d I dispose of the same as follows

First I give to my Son John Cross the Sum of Fifteen Pounds

I also give to my daughter Mary the Wife of John Dalby the Sum of Fifteen pounds & my Will is that they the said Legacies be paid to the respective Legatees within twelve months after my decease and my will further is that if either my Said Son or daughter should happen to depart this Life before his or her Legacy become Due, that then his or her Legacy be paid to the Child or Children of Such deceased Legatee in equall Shares

I also give to my Daughter Elizabeth the Widow of John Wiseman the Sum of Fifteen Pounds to be paid her by my Executor within twelve Months after my decease

I also give to my Granddaughter Elizabeth the daughter of my late daughter Ann Cross the Sum of Twenty Five pounds to be paid by my Executor and by him apply’d towards the maintenance and Education of my said Granddaughter in such manner and at such time or times as he shall see Convenient

I also give to my Son in Law William Rouse the Sum of Four Pounds

I also give to Grandaughter Mary the daughter of John Dalby my Oval Table that stands in my Parlour

Also the then rest and residue of my Goods Chattels Cattle money Securities for money &c and personal Estate of what nature or kind the same are and in whose Custody it may be found (after all the aforesaid Legacies are paid and my Just debts and funeral Expences Discharged) I give to my Son William Cross whom I hereby nominate and appoint full and Sole Executor of this my Will hereby revoking all former Wills at any time heretofore by me made confirming this only as my last Will and Testament

In Wittness whereof I the said Testator have hereunto set my hand and Seal this Twenty third day of August One thousand Seven hundred and Seventy three

                                                                                                         John Cross his Mark

Signed sealed published and declared by the within named Testator for and as his Last Will and Testament in the presence of us who have Subscribed our names as Witnesses in his Presence at his request

W Barnes

Wm Palmer

On the 9th day of May 1776 Wm Cross the sole Executor within named was sworn to the due Execution hereof
